
Benoni Smith Hunt
The Hunt family traveled to the Salt Lake Valley with the Aaron Johnson Company in 1850. The Hunt family included Daniel Durham and his wife Susan Davis, and Daniel’s children from his first wife: John Alexander, James Wiseman, Levi Bunyan, Benoni Smith, Daniel Whitmore, and Nancy Johanna Penelope. Susan Davis Hunt died en route. Daniel was the chaplain of the company.
